| "Support Needed to Bolster Liberia's Police Force", UNMIL Loj Monrovia, Liberia – UN Envoy Ellen Margrethe Løj has commended the Norwegian Government for recognizing that the recovery and development of Liberia’s rule of law institutions “requires an additional bolster to both human and financial resources”. Ms. Loj was speaking at a ceremony in Monrovia to honor the Norwegian contingent of the UN Mission in Liberia (UNMIL). The Special Representative of the Secretary-General (SRSG) stated that “Norway had provided over US$1.5 million in 2006 and 2007 for the construction of 10 LNP County Headquarters buildings, all with women and children protection facilities attached”.
